.logo {width:175px;margin-right:10px;}
.logo:hover, .logo:active, .logo:visited {border:none;}
.ramka{border:1px solid #710000;}

.error{font-weight: bold;}
.noaccess{border: 1px solid #D92323;color: #D92323;font-size: 1.4em;margin: 10px 0;padding: 10px;
    border-radius: 15px 2px;
    -moz-border-radius: 15px 2px;
/*    -webkit-border-radius: 15px 2px;*/
    box-shadow: 0 0 5px #D92323;
    -moz-box-shadow: 0 0 5px #D92323;
    -webkit-box-shadow: 0 0 5px #D92323;
}

/*.blocker{background: black; opacity: 0.9;filter:alpha(opacity=90);}*/
.wait{background: no-repeat center center url(img/ajax-loader.gif);}
form.wait{opacity: .5;filter:alpha(opacity=50);}
form.login.wait{background-image: none;}
/*form .blocker{visibility: hidden;}*/


.bottom .navi{display: block;margin: 10px 20px 10px 35px;border-top: 1px dashed #4d022a;}
.navi{text-align: center; font-size: 10px;padding:5px 0;line-height: 12px;}
.navi ul{margin: 0;}
.navi li{display: inline;padding-right: 5px;border-right: 1px solid black;}
.navi li.ostatni{border-right: none;}
.navi li a.disabled{color: lightgrey; text-decoration: none; }
.navi li a.disabled:hover{color: lightgrey; cursor: default;}

a.more{color: whitesmoke;display: block;float: right;font-size: 10px;line-height: 17px;margin-right: 10px;width: 73px;height: 27px;text-indent: 12px;}
a.more:hover{}

.doc_signature{text-align: right;}
.nadtytul{text-decoration: underline;font-weight: normal;font-size: 12px;}
.wstep{}

.link_baner{width: 179px;height: 104px;background: url(img/button_links.png) no-repeat;}
